MARYLAND STATUTES AND CODES

Section 17-502 - Examinations.

§ 17-502. Examinations.
 

(a)  In general.- An applicant who otherwise qualifies for a license or certificate is entitled to be examined as provided in this section. 

(b)  Time and place of twice-yearly examinations.- The Board shall give examinations to applicants at least twice a year, at the times and places that the Board determines. 

(c)  Notification of time and place.- The Board shall notify each qualified applicant of the time and place of examination. 

(d)  Number of times of taking examination not limited.-  

(1) The Board may not limit the number of times an applicant may take an examination required under this title. 

(2) The applicant shall pay to the Board a reexamination fee set by the Board for each reexamination. 

(e)  Testing of knowledge of Maryland Professional Counselors and Therapists Act.- The examination shall include a portion that tests an applicant's knowledge of the Maryland Professional Counselors and Therapists Act. 
 

[2008, ch. 505, §§ 1, 2.]
